Jackie Shroff’s wife Ayesha Shroff has filed a case of cheating at the Santacruz police station. According to police, she was duped of Rs 58 lakh. A case has been registered against accused Alan Fernandes, under IPC sections 420, 408, 465, 467 and 468. The investigation into this matter is underway, said Mumbai police. Further details are awaited. 

Accused Alan Fernandes was appointed as Director of Operations in MMA Matrix Company on November 20, 2018. MMA Matrix gym belongs to Tiger Shroff and since he is busy with film work, his mother Ayesha was looking after all the activities there. According to police, Alan Fernandes was hired by the MMA Matrix company to train the recruits in martial arts on a monthly salary of Rs 3 lakh.

The accused took a lot of money for organising a total of 11 tournaments in India and outside India through the company and the total amount of fees collected from December 2018 to January 2023 was Rs 58,53,591 in the company’s bank account.

Ayesha had previously filed a complaint against actor Sahil Khan in 2015 over allegations of cheating and criminal intimidation and an issue of non-payment of dues by Khan worth over Rs 4 crore.
